how to say “debut” in Hebrew

 

בְּכוֹרָה

 

 
You may know the Hebrew word for firstborn, בְּכוֹר  listen and repeat.
 
Modern Hebrew calls upon the word בכור to produce a word for the more contemporary concept of a debut – בְּכוֹרָה  listen and repeat.
 
For example:
 
הָיִנוּ בְּמוֹפַע הַבְּכוֹרָה שֶׁלָּהּ.
We were at her debut performance.
